Is Keepvid.ch Still Safe to Use?
For a video downloader, safety is always the first concern. However, the truth is: the original Keepvid service stopped its traditional downloading functions years ago, because of legal pressure and the shift in streaming technology.
Today, most websites using the "Keepvid" name are unofficial clones. These sites often survive on aggressive ad-tracking and malicious redirects.
